Madam, She Has A Tender Heart Chapter 97: Do You Remember Him?

On the night of the second day of the Chinese New Year, Su Qingliu stayed at Lu’s house to accompany her.

The two sisters and Yaya lay on the same bed and talked all night, talking about the shop, Madam Ma, and their husbands, whose lives were unknown.

“My meifu has been gone for half a year. Do you miss him?”

“I think so. We are husband and wife, and I hope he can live. Even if his arms and legs are broken and his body is incomplete, I still hope he can live.”

“Yes, being alive is better than being dead. My meifu is still a little bit skilled and knows a few martial arts, but Yaya’s father has nothing but a lot of strength… It’s been almost three years, and I don’t know if he’s dead or alive…”

Su Qingyu fell silent after hearing this.

The battlefield had always been cruel. In the era of cold weapons, the tactics of human waves were used, and the battlefield was filled with heads. Behind every victory, there were countless piles of dead bones.

“Jie, do you still remember Jiefu?”

“Of course, I remember. Although your jiefu is dull, he is a very good person and protected me at home. His shūshū and shěnshen didn’t like him, so he often told me that he and I were the only family and that we should live a good life together. Even when his shūshū and shěnshen scolded me, he always protected me… He left before Yaya was born. I don’t know if they will be able to meet in the future”.

“If you think you can, then you can. If you keep thinking about it, there will be a response. Jie, as long as you believe firmly, jiefu will definitely come back.”

“If you keep thinking about it, there will be a response…” Su Qingliu murmured this sentence and nodded heavily in the darkness.

The next day, after Yaya woke up, the two sisters took Yaya to Yangwei Martial Arts School again.

Madam Ma was very happy to see Yaya. She played with Yaya for a long time and fed her personally. Her every move showed her tenderness and love. If someone who didn’t know the situation saw it, they would definitely think they were a mother and daughter.

In the afternoon, Su Dahu also returned to the town and brought two large cages of old hens for Su Qingyu.

The three of them sat and chatted in the shop for a while, and then Su Qingliu sent her back to Lu’s house. Lu Shengcai and his family came back, and Su Qingliu took Yaya to sleep in the shop.

“Your grandparents keep praising you, saying that you are sensible.”

Lu Shengcai sat on a chair in the main room, watching Wu Shi pack up the local specialties she brought back home while talking to Su Qingyu with a smile on his face.

“Is everything alright at home? Are grandpa and grandma in good health?”

“They are fine. They are in good health, so you don’t have to worry about them. Your grandparents wore the clothes you made for them during the New Year, and they praised their new granddaughter-in-law for being sensible. Many people in the village praised you, saying that you bought their fruits, vegetables, eggs, chickens, ducks, etc. last year, and every family is much richer than in previous years. When I left, they stuffed a lot of local specialities for me to bring back to you.”

“The villagers are so polite. This is a mutually beneficial thing.”

“That’s right. People who don’t know the truth would think that they have received a great favor from you.” Lu Yuzhu said with a sullen face and a pout.

Su Qingyu glanced at her after hearing that. As soon as she came in, she saw that she looked unhappy. If someone didn’t know the truth, they would think that she had suffered a lot in her hometown during the New Year.

“Lu Yuzhu, are you unable to learn how to speak or what? Why are you talking to your family in this tone? How old are you? You are sixteen this year. Look at you like this. Who would dare to come to your house to propose marriage?”

Lu Shengcai frowned tightly.

Su Qingyu turned her gaze away indifferently, not taking it to heart at all.

A long time ago, she gave up the extravagant hope of being respected as the eldest sister-in-law by Wu Shi’s children. She treated people the way they treated her and avoided them if she could, but if she couldn’t avoid them, she would just treat them as venting their anger.

Lu Yuzhu was still very afraid of Lu Shengcai. When she saw Lu Shengcai scolding her, she turned around and said to Wu Shi, “Mom, go and boil some water. I want to take a bath. I have to go play with Yueru later.”

As she said this, she pulled her sleeve and sniffed it, with a look of disgust on her face.

Lu Shengcai frowned so hard that a fly could be pinched to death: “Lu Yuzhu, you think it’s unfair for you to go back to your hometown? Your roots are there! Your old father will be buried there in the future! Are you too disgusted to burn paper for me?”
Lu Yuzhu opened her mouth and then closed it again.
Mrs. Wu glared at him and said, “It’s New Year’s Day; why are you arguing with the child? She’s used to sleeping in her bed, so what’s wrong with her complaining? The food at home doesn’t suit her taste, so she can’t even mention it?”
“Our family has provided us with meat and fish for every meal, and the table is full of dishes. How come you can’t eat anymore?” Lu Shengcai was provoked by Wu Shi and was about to stand up and slam the table.

Wu Shi quickly winked at Lu Yuzhu, who got the hint and ran out in a flash.

Lu Shengcai was very angry: “Look at her like this, which matchmaker would dare to come to her house to propose marriage!”

“If that pockmarked guy from North Street, who doesn’t even eat all year round, can get married, how can Yuzhu not get married? When Bozu becomes famous in the future, many people will come to propose marriage to him”. Wu Shi was not worried about Lu Yuzhu’s marriage at all.

Ever since Lü Bozu introduced a high-ranking marriage to Wu Shi, she straightened her back and visited more often, holding her head high, enjoying everyone’s compliments with great delight.

Lü Shengcai was so angry that he stormed out. Lü Bozu and Lü Bozong also ran away, while Su Qingyu was stopped by Wu Shi and took the local produce from the countryside to the kitchen to put away.

Wu Shi also asked her to boil some hot water for Lu Yuzhu.

On the fourth day of the New Year, Su Qingyu did not go out, Su Dahu ran to the countryside, and Su Qingliu cleaned up the shop.

On the fifth day of the first lunar month, after welcoming the God of Wealth, Su Qingyu set off a string of firecrackers at the door of the shop and opened her convenience store for business.

Granny Zhou and her grandchildren also arrived at the store early and helped put fruits, vegetables, meat, poultry and eggs on the shelves.

There were not many customers today, and they were all residents of the town. Although there were few people, since only Su Qingyu’s store was open among the three stores, business was still good.

Old man Xie came early in the morning with his old servant and Xie Qiyou, and the two sides exchanged New Year greetings. Old man Xie teased Su Qingyu as usual, complaining that there were not enough people in the store, and asked her to work hard and not fall behind in paying his rent.

Xie Qiyou played with Yaya for a while but soon lost interest when he saw that Qingxing and Qingyang had not returned. The grandparents and grandson followed the old servant who had selected the vegetables and went back together.

Because it was still the first month of the lunar year, all business came only from the town, demand was not great, and there were not many people in the store. It was not until after the Lantern Festival, when the private school started, that Father Su brought Qingyang and Qingxing to the town.

As soon as the two little ones returned to the town, they jumped for joy just like Yaya, holding onto Su Qingyu and refusing to let go. Though they had only been separated for half a month, it seemed like they hadn’t seen each other for a long time.

The two little ones were afraid of being scolded in the countryside, and the eldest room was an honest family, so they all kept a low profile in their lives. Only when they arrived in town did the two little ones become lively like children.

Father Su started to run to the countryside. Qingyang started to go to school early and come back late, while Qingxing took Yaya with her and helped out in the store. When school was over every day, Qingxing would run to the gate of the private school to wait for her two brothers. The three of them would play together until sunset before going home.

On days when she was not attending private school, the three of them would take Yaya to Yangwei Martial Arts Hall to accompany Madam Ma and watch the disciples practice martial arts in the hall.

The days passed by like this until the end of the first month of the year, when bad news came.
